My Project
My students learn in so many different ways. Some require more hands-on instruction to stay engaged and focused. My students enjoy working together during small group work, completing math tasks or guided reading. A whiteboard table will make it easier to work with these students up close while keeping them focused and engaged to task at hand.
A whiteboard kidney table would give me a place to teach while remaining engaged with my students.
A whiteboard kidney table would change the dynamic in our classroom and get students more involved and engaged during small group work, conferencing, and individual activities.
